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

chore: use nuxt island to render storybook stories #1728

Closed
wants to merge 13 commits into from

Conversation

tobiasdiez
Copy link
Member

@tobiasdiez tobiasdiez commented Jan 28, 2023

Call http://localhost:3000/__nuxt_island/Storybook.
Question: is there also a method that one call useNuxt().render(island component, props) instead of calling the url endpoint. Problem is namely that we get some js objects from storybook and want to render them, without prior serialization. I've opened nuxt/nuxt#18596 for this. Maybe use nitroApp.localCall?

Maybe related: nuxt/framework#5723 (comment)

Also needs SSR, which is currently blocked #1725

Reference:

@tobiasdiez tobiasdiez added the status: blocked Blocked by an issue / missing feature of a dependency, or by another issue label Jan 29, 2023
@OlaAlsaker
Copy link

This looks really promising, good job so far! 👏

@tobiasdiez
Copy link
Member Author

Closing this for now. Couldn't figure out a good way to let nuxt only render the story, since eveything is build by the storybook vite. Will revisit this problem and probably will implement a new storybook build that directly uses the nuxt pipeline to build the storybook.

@tobiasdiez tobiasdiez closed this Jun 27, 2023
@tobiasdiez tobiasdiez deleted the storybook-islandrenderer branch June 27, 2023 13:36
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
status: blocked Blocked by an issue / missing feature of a dependency, or by another issue
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ants